What is the role of an assistant computer hardware maintenance?

An assistant computer hardware maintenance technician supports the installation, troubleshooting, and repair of computer hardware components such as motherboards, hard drives, and peripherals. They often work under supervision to ensure hardware systems function properly and may use diagnostic tools or follow maintenance schedules. Basic knowledge of hardware components and safety procedures is essential for this role.

What is the difference between Assistant Computer Hardware Maintenance vs Computer Hardware Technician?

AspectAssistant Computer Hardware MaintenanceComputer Hardware Technician
CertificationsBasic hardware support, CompTIA A+ often preferredAdvanced certifications like CompTIA A+, Cisco, or manufacturer-specific
Work EnvironmentEntry-level, support roles in offices, repair shopsHands-on repair, troubleshooting in labs or client sites
ResponsibilitiesAssisting in hardware setup, basic troubleshooting, routine maintenanceDiagnosing, repairing, replacing hardware components
Industry UsageCommon in IT support teams, retail, small businessesFound in repair centers, corporate IT departments, service providers

While both roles involve hardware support, the Assistant Computer Hardware Maintenance position is more entry-level, focusing on assisting with basic tasks. The Computer Hardware Technician handles more complex repairs and diagnostics, requiring advanced skills and certifications.
